Last War Survival Drone Upgrade Guide: Components, Chips, and Common Mistakes

The Last War Survival drone unlocks around server day 82 and immediately becomes one of the highest-return passive systems in the game. Most players ignore it or mismanage resources early and fall behind. This guide covers every system: Data Training, Components, and Skill Chips, with exact priorities and mistakes to avoid in Season 6.

Why the Tactical Drone Matters in Last War Survival Season 6

The Last War Survival drone is not a side feature; it is a squad-wide stat multiplier that fights in every battle on the world map, in PvE, and in PvP. It cannot be targeted by enemies, and every level, Component, and Skill Chip added produces flat buffs across your entire hero lineup (per in-game tooltip, confirmed in-game).

Core Drone Systems and Unlock Timeline

The Last War Survival drone has four connected systems that unlock progressively. Understanding the timeline prevents wasted resources before systems are available.

Unlock Milestones Table

Server Day / HQ LevelFeature Unlocked
HQ 15Component Factory: produces drone components
Server Day ~82Combat Boost and Skill Chips system activates
HQ 30 (Age of Oil research)Drone Parts Factory: passive daily parts production
Chip Lab Level 20Legendary chip crafting unlocks
Chip Lab Level 10First Combat Boost preset slot opens

Basic Systems Overview

Four systems make up the full Last War Survival drone progression. Data Training uses Battle Data EXP cards to level the drone and convert stats to heroes. Components are six equipment pieces that slot into the drone frame and directly boost combat stats. Combat Boost levels up using unwanted chips and unlocks the Skill Chip system. Skill Chips are the highest-impact late-game layer, featuring four chip types that boost specific stats and trigger at different battle moments.

Data Training, Drone Parts, and Leveling Strategy

Leveling the Last War Survival drone requires Battle Data EXP cards for standard progress and Drone Parts for benchmark checkpoints. The two resources serve different functions and should never be treated as interchangeable.

Data Training Mechanics & Crit System

When the upgrade bar is below 80% progress toward the next level, each Battle Data use has a 50% chance to crit and grant double EXP . Once the bar passes 80%, crits are disabled. The correct approach is to use Battle Data while below 80%, stop at 79% if you cannot finish a level in one session, then continue next session from the crit window.

Levels that require Drone Parts also disable crits, which is a separate reason to stockpile Parts and spend them in bulk rather than drip-feeding them.

Benchmark Costs & Part Management Table

Benchmarks trigger every 5 levels and require Drone Parts alongside Battle Data. Costs rise sharply in the mid-range and then reduce significantly at level 150 (community-verified, Season 6 progression data):

Level RangeParts Per Benchmark StageNotes
1 to 50Low to moderateEarly game: Parts relatively accessible
50 to 110Rising sharplyBiggest bottleneck window
110 to 145Highest costMost players stall here without factory investment
150+~500 parts per stageCost drops: push to this threshold

Skill Unlocks at Key Levels

New skills unlock at levels 30, 50, 70, 90, and 110. These are the power spike thresholds worth planning resources around. Level 40 and Level 70 are widely identified as the most significant squad-wide combat buff unlocks. Prioritize hitting them before diversifying into Components or Chips.

Factory Production Tips (Components & Parts)

The Component Factory unlocks at HQ 15 and produces up to 7 components per day at max level 19. The Drone Parts Factory unlocks via Age of Oil research at HQ 30 and produces up to 6 parts per day at max level 30. Both factories run passively. Treat them as mandatory investments and upgrade them as early as resources allow. Events, alliance stores, and campaign rewards supplement factory output but cannot replace it.

Drone Components: Defensive vs Offensive Balance

Six components slot into the Last War Survival drone frame and each one provides specific stat boosts. The split between defensive and offensive types is the most common source of imbalance in player drones.

6 Components Overview Table

ComponentSideMain BoostDrop RatePriority
RadarDefensive (Left)Detection, DEF~22%Build first (easier to acquire)
EngineDefensive (Left)Speed, HP~22%Build consistently
ArmorDefensive (Left)DEF scaling~22%Build consistently
MissileOffensive (Right)ATK output~11%Use choice chests here
Fuel CellOffensive (Right)Energy damage~11%Use choice chests here
Thermal ImagerOffensive (Right)Crit ATK~11%Use choice chests here

Defensive (Left) vs Offensive (Right) Priority & Drop Rates

Defensive components drop at approximately 22% each while offensive components drop at approximately 11% each (community-verified, Season 6 drone data). This means most players naturally over-build defensive stats and under-build offensive output, resulting in a drone that survives but does not contribute meaningfully to squad damage.

Factory Optimization & Choice Chests

The fix is straightforward. Always use Component Choice Chests for right-side offensive parts. Never spend choice chests on defensive components when random drops already favor them.

Merge & Upgrade Process

Merge three identical components of the same level to produce one higher-level component. Continue this 3-to-1 merge path until level 7, then use any excess as XP fodder rather than continuing to merge. Opening component chests and merging on Wednesday during alliance Duel VS events earns bonus points from these actions simultaneously.

Combat Boost and Skill Chips Deep Dive

The Skill Chip system is the single largest power jump available in the Last War Survival drone. It activates when Combat Boost reaches level 10, which unlocks the first chip preset slot.

Combat Boost Progression & Presets

Use unwanted Common and Rare chips as EXP fodder to level Combat Boost. The first preset slot opens at level 10. Each additional preset requires higher Combat Boost levels. Push Chip Lab to level 20 as fast as resources allow, since Legendary chip crafting only unlocks at that threshold.

4 Chip Types & Trigger Timing Table

Chip TypeTrigger TimingPrimary Effect2026 Priority
InterferenceOn enemy skill useReduces enemy tactic damageFirst: counters burst meta
DefenseFull battle durationDEF buff for matched hero type + global minor buffSecond
Initial MoveBattle start (first seconds)Shield for opening phaseThird
AttackOn drone bomb triggerATK amplifier for matched squad typeFourth

Legendary vs Epic Comparison & When to Switch

Epic chips help level Combat Boost. Legendary chips provide full-battle-duration effects and unlock the ascension system. Epic chips do not. Switch to Legendary chips as soon as Chip Lab reaches level 20. Craft Legendary chips only for your main squad type. Legendary materials are extremely limited and wasted on secondary squads (per in-game tooltip).

Ascension, Squad Matching & Optimization

Match chips to your primary squad type (Tank, Aircraft, or Missile) for the full typed buff plus a smaller global bonus. Ascension for Legendary chips provides major power spikes at each ascension benchmark. Always ascend the chip you use most before starting a new chip's ascension path.

Common Mistakes, Optimization & Resource Sources

Even experienced players make systematic errors with the Last War Survival drone that compound into significant power deficits over a season.

Top 5 Mistakes to Avoid

MistakeWhy It HurtsFix
Ignoring Component and Parts FactoriesLeaves daily free resources uncollectedUpgrade both factories immediately at HQ unlock
Over-building defensive componentsDrone survives but underperforms on damageUse all choice chests on offensive right-side parts
Keeping Epic chips past level 20 Chip LabMisses full-battle Legendary effects and ascensionSwitch to Legendary crafting immediately at lab level 20
Assigning chips to wrong squad typeTyped buff is wastedMatch every chip to your main squad (Tank, Aircraft, or Missile)
Spending Battle Data past 80% progressWastes all crit chancesStop at 79% and continue next session from the crit window

Daily & Weekly Resource Routes

  • Component Factory: collect daily at max level (7 components per day at level 19)
  • Parts Factory: collect daily at max level (6 parts per day at level 30)
  • Alliance store: buy chip EXP cards weekly before reset
  • Drone Development duel days: save Parts for these events (points awarded for spending)
  • Events: supplement with Component Chests and Skill Chip Chests from seasonal events

Long-Term Optimization Strategy

The Last War Survival drone rewards consistent daily habits more than any single large resource dump. Set a daily routine around factory collection, crit window leveling, and weekly chip events. Focus all Legendary materials on one chip for your main squad before starting a second. Players who build steadily from day 82 reach level 100 comfortably by month 2 to 3 of the season

Final Verdict: Drone Priority in Your Season 6 Progression

The Last War Survival drone is a long-burn power system. Here is the exact investment order by game stage.

Priority Recommendations by Player Stage

StageFocus
Early (Day 82 to Level 50)Data Training daily + upgrade both factories + start Components
Mid (Level 50 to Level 100)Combat Boost to level 10 + first Legendary chip for main squad
Late (Level 100+)Chip ascension + second preset + aggressive offensive component balancing

FAQs

Q1: When does the drone unlock in Last War Survival Season 6?

A: The drone system fully activates around server day 82. Components unlock earlier at HQ 15 via the Component Factory. Combat Boost and Skill Chips activate at day 82 when Combat Boost reaches level 10 inside the Age of Oil research tree.

Q2: Should I use Epic or Legendary skill chips?

A: Switch to Legendary chips as soon as the Chip Lab reaches level 20. Legendary chips provide full-battle-duration effects and ascension potential that maxed Epic chips cannot match. Use Epic chips only as Combat Boost EXP fodder until that threshold.

Q3: What is the best way to get Drone Parts?
